John Marin (American, 1870-1953)
Campanile San Pietro, Venice, 1907, edition of approximately 40, printed by Ernest Haskell, New York (Zigrosser, 57). Signed "John Marin" in pencil l.r., titled within the plate. Etching and drypoint on Japan paper, plate size 6 3/4 x 5 in. (17.1 x 12.5 cm),matted, unframed.
Condition: Creases to sheet (including image, possibly from printing),minor thinned spots and nicks to edges of sheet, minor soiling to lower edge, margins approximately 7/8 inches.
